** The Mercedes-Benz repair market for the Pinehurst area is characterized by high-quality, specialized independent shops that compete directly with the authorized dealerships in Boston's western suburbs. The competition is strong, which benefits the consumer through competitive pricing and a focus on customer service. * **Average Quality:** The quality of service is generally very high. The independent specialists (like Rennwerke and Euromotive) often employ technicians with dealership backgrounds, offering a comparable level of expertise at a lower labor rate. * **Competition Level:** High. There is a healthy mix of long-standing dealerships and highly-rated independent specialists. This forces all providers to maintain excellent standards to retain their discerning clientele. * **Typical Pricing:** Labor rates are premium, reflecting the Greater Boston area's cost of living and the specialized nature of the work. Authorized dealerships typically command the highest labor rates ($200-$250/hr), while top-tier independents are slightly more affordable ($165-$195/hr). However, the independent shops often provide significant savings on parts without sacrificing quality, using OEM or superior aftermarket components. A complex service like an AIRMATIC strut replacement or transmission service will be a major investment at any of these establishments, but the work will be performed correctly.

Given Pinehurst's cold winters and use of road salt, we frequently address undercarriage corrosion, suspension component wear from potholes, and issues with the AIRMATIC suspension system. Battery failures are also common during sudden temperature drops, stressing the electrical system.
Look for shops specifically advertising Mercedes-Benz or European auto service with certified technicians (ASE or Mercedes-specific training). In Pinehurst, a quality independent shop should have direct experience with local driving conditions and use OEM or high-quality aftermarket parts, often at a lower labor rate than the Boston-area dealerships.
Seek service immediately if the light is flashing or if you notice a loss of power, as this could indicate a serious issue. For a steady light, schedule a diagnostic scan promptly, as Massachusetts state inspection will fail your vehicle if any emissions-related fault codes are present.
Yes, repairs and maintenance are typically higher due to specialized parts, required proprietary diagnostic tools, and the technical expertise needed. However, establishing a relationship with a trusted local specialist can help manage costs through preventative maintenance, especially before our harsh winter season.
Prioritize seasonal tire changes and frequent undercarriage washes in winter to combat road salt corrosion. Also, schedule pre-winter inspections for your battery and AIRMATIC system, as our freeze-thaw cycles and rough back roads can accelerate wear on these expensive components.
